What is a Submersible Well Pump?


A submersible well pump is a type of pump that is fully submerged in the water it’s designed to pump. Unlike jet pumps, which are installed above ground, submersible pumps consist of a motor, impellers, and other components that are sealed within a waterproof casing. This design allows the pump to efficiently push water to the surface, providing a reliable and consistent water supply.

Features of a 3% Horsepower Submersible Pump


1. Energy Efficiency A submersible well pump with a respectable horsepower rating is often more energy-efficient than its above-ground counterparts. They are designed to minimize energy losses and optimize performance, making them ideal for pumping applications that require consistent water flow.


2. Durability These pumps are constructed with robust materials that can withstand the harsh environment of deep wells. The motors are sealed to prevent water intrusion, and the impellers are designed to resist wear and tear, ensuring a longer lifespan.


3. Reduced Noise Since submersible pumps operate underwater, they produce significantly less noise compared to surface pumps. This feature is particularly appealing for residential areas where noise pollution can be a concern.

Applications of a 3% Horsepower Submersible Well Pump


Submersible well pumps have a wide range of applications across various sectors. Here are some common uses


- Residential Water Supply Homeowners often install submersible pumps to access groundwater for household use, irrigation, or garden maintenance. - Agricultural Irrigation Farmers utilize these pumps to deliver water to crops, especially in regions where surface water is scarce.


- Industrial Applications Many industries require a reliable water source for processes such as manufacturing or cooling systems. Submersible pumps are often used to meet these needs.


- Municipal Water Systems Submersible pumps are also installed in municipal water systems to help in the distribution of water to communities.
